WebThe Buttercup family (Ranunculaceae) has 2000 species in 50 genera.It has two main subfamilies – Ranunculoideae which includes Buttercup, Hellebore, Trollius, Anemone, Nigella, Pulsatilla, Clematis, Aconitum, … WebNov 2, 2024 · The term Aconite is reserved for the flowering plants of the buttercup family. What we call aconite flowers are largely divided into two groups: genus Aconitum, also known as ‘monkshood’ is home to summer-flowering poisonous plants, and the genus Eranthis (winter aconite) consisting of spring-flowering ornamentals. Web1 day ago · Buttercup species that are common to PA include: bulbous buttercup ( Ranunculus bulbosus ), creeping buttercup ( Ranunculus repens ), tall buttercup ( Ranunculus acris ), and small flower buttercup ( Ranunculus arbortivus ). Most of these have a perennial lifecycle, however some can behave as a winter annual.
